For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 892 students in Wilburton School District. This district's average test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Oklahoma.
51爆料s in Wilburton School District have an average math proficiency score of 26% (versus the Oklahoma public school average of 25%), and reading proficiency score of 22% (versus the 27%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is less than the Oklahoma public school average of 56% (majority Hispanic and American Indian).

Wilburton School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 534 school districts in Oklahoma (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 80-89% has decreased from 90%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$9,516 in this school district is less than the state median of $10,950. The school district revenue/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$9,519 is less than the state median of $10,925. The school district spending/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
